I don't generally work on my car where I park its to dark. Most of the pics I take from there are when I'm running my engine for a bit. We have a wash bay/loading bay where me and a few others work on our cars, but no major work can be done there (nothing that can spill oil or coolant). Once I finalize my interior and get my rims back on (pretty much all my current tires are shot/ugly as hell basically not safe to drive on) Then its off to my shop for top end work and then to exhaust shop for new muffler, C6 tips, remove the cat and connect the 3400 downpipe.
